How Shocker Air Ride Works
Built-In Air Spring
A heavy-duty air bag under the receiver tube soaks up the jerking, tugging, and hard hits before they ever reach your truck or trailer. There is no rigid steel connection passing shock straight through.
Adjustable for Any Load
Pump in air for a heavy load or bleed some off for a light one. Set the pressure so the hitch sits at the right ride height every single time you hook up.
Rocker-Arm Pivot
Shocker's signature down-and-back motion rides on a single pivot, with no slides, rollers, parallel linkages, or stacked airbags. Fewer parts moving means fewer parts to wear out.
Dual Bump Cushions
Two backup rubber cushions catch the extreme jolts the air bag cannot fully swallow, so the system always has a second line of defense under a heavy hit.

Sway Control: Two Configurations
The Original line ships with or without sway-control tabs, depending on the ball-mount attachment you pick:
Standard Ball Mount (No Sway Tabs)
Right for boats, livestock trailers, equipment haulers, and any load that does not need friction sway bars. The pivoting air-ride design already cuts down on sway tendency on its own.
Ball Mount With Welded Sway Tabs
Adds welded tabs for a friction sway-bar kit (sold separately). The pick for travel trailers and tall-profile campers that catch a crosswind and start to wander.
Flippable Drop / Rise Geometry
This Shocker Air Hitch & Raised Ball Mount w/ 2" Ball ships in a 2" Rise to 2" Drop configuration. Most Shocker ball mounts flip right over, so you can turn drop into rise, and the 8 adjustment holes let you fine-tune coupler height on top of that. Tow a low travel trailer behind a lifted truck or a tall camper behind a stock pickup, and you can set it to sit level either way.
